Selling Business

Are you thinking about selling your business?  If so, the advice and counsel of a good business broker should be in the forefront of your mind.  Business brokers know the marketplace and what buyers are looking for in a business purchase.  So, a good business broker will pay for himself many times over, either by actually selling the business, which there is a limited market for, or buy fetching the highest possible purchase price.  So, if you are thinking about selling business, start with examine the local market for business brokers in Austin, Texas or in Travis county, Williamson county, Hays county or any other local region in the area.

If you are a buyer or seller in the Austin or San Antonio area, let’s talk about the process of selling business.  While this can be difficult process, we make it easy on buyers and sellers.  From our expert knowledge of the process, we can help you find what you are looking for.  If you are a seller, we will try to help maximize the sales price of your business.  We do this through the many buyers we have on our buyer list.  We try to create competition among these buyers for your business.  This will many times help raise the price that a buyer is willing to pay for your business.  As a potential business buyer, we show you the pitfalls that many business brokers use to show a higher seller’s discretionary earnings.  We can cut right to the chase during due diligence and find some of the deal killers.  If you are thinking about buying or selling business, let us help you create your next mergers and acquisitions transaction.
